Horicon Man Given Jail Time For Pursuit

(Beaver Dam) A Horicon man was sentenced to 140 days in jail for initiating a pursuit with Dodge County authorities. Richard Hron entered a no contest plea to a felony count of Fleeing. An additional misdemeanor count of Possession Drug Paraphernalia was dismissed but read into the record.

A sheriff’s deputy was alerted just before 3am in September that a vehicle was heading west on Highway 33 with no headlights on. It was also swerving within its lane and crossing the centerline. After the deputy activated their emergency lights, the suspect vehicle turned on its own lights and accelerated away.

The vehicle reached speeds of 75-miles-per-hour as it headed north on Highway 151 before stopping in front of spike strips that were deployed in the roadway. The driver, identified as Hron, was arrested during a high-risk traffic stop.

The 32-year-old was also placed on probation for two years.
